On a Cisco switch I use the command
"show mac-address-table address xxxx.xxxx.xxxx"
and it will tell me what ports it has seen that MAC on. I use this to track
down the location of offending devices or anytime I want to know which
equipment is behind what port.

Is there an equivalent I can use on a routerboard with multiple ports
bridged? I have a RB493AH acting as a switch and would like to remotely
figure out which devices are on what ports.
